By Victor Flores, Bozeman Daily Chronicle: Bryson Parker, a defensive back who most recently played at Nevada, announced his commitment to Montana State on Thursday.
The 6-foot, 182-pound Parker has two seasons of college football eligibility remaining, according to his transfer portal entrance announcement last month.
MSU was one of multiple FCS programs to extend offers to him, along with Bryant, Campbell, Mercer and Idaho State (which plays in the Big Sky Conference with MSU).
